Gene Steven Fodor, age 84, of the Point/Shoreland Community, died Saturday February 17, 2018 at home. He was born November 16, 1933 to Mr. & Mrs. Julius (Margaret Tima) Fodor, who immigrated from Hungary. Gene was a proud 1st generation Hungarian-American, who was raised in the Birmingham neighborhood. He proudly served his country and was both a U.S. Marine Corps and U.S. Air Force Veteran, being deployed to Korea with both branches of the military. Gene graduated from the Toledo Police Academy in 1959 and worked in both Field Operations and the Detective Bureau, where he worked in the intelligence unit from 1965 until it was dissolved in 1977. He retired on December 31, 1987. He was a member of Riverview Yacht Club, Toledo; American Legion Post 512 and Fraternal Order of Police, Lodge 40. He was active with the Birmingham Hall of Fame, where he had been inducted and currently served as Secretary. Gene graduated from Waite High School. Gene enjoyed a long and active retirement. Above all things his family was the most important thing to him.
